Studiotorino

Studiotorino is an Italian automotive design house, specialised in fine sportscars completely handmade. It was founded on 1 January 2005 in Rivoli by Alfredo and Maria Paola Stola with the contribution of Marco Goffi.

The company, even though young, represents by Alfredo Stola an important milestone in the Italian history and coachbuilder tradition: his grandfather in 1919 founded the "Alfredo Stola", receiving at that time the personal estimation of Vincenzo Lancia, thank to the high quality of their model works.[1]

Reward/awards

RK Spyder winner of the concours “L’auto più bella del mondo”, 3 March 2006 at the Palazzo della Triennale in Milan – category sportscars RK Coupè winner of the concours “L’auto più bella del mondo”, 11 April 2007 at the “Salone dell’automobile” in Shanghai – category sportscars
